MANCHESTER, NH – State Representative Mary Stuart Gile (Concord) announced today that she is supporting Senator Chris Dodd for the 2008 Democratic Presidential Nomination.  Gile is in her sixth term representing wards 1, 2, and 3 in Concord.

“Chris Dodd has spent his career championing legislation on behalf of American working families and children, the environment, education, health care and has fought to protect American jobs,” said Representative Gile.  “Senator Dodd’s record of over two decades in the U.S. Senate is one of outstanding accomplishment.  His agenda is one of hope and renewal through service to our fellow citizens and to our nation. This vision combined with his effectiveness as a leader gives Senator Dodd the potential to be a great president.”

Mary Stuart Gile is in her sixth term as a State Representative from Concord.  She is the Chair of the Children and Family Law Committee, and the Chair of the New Hampshire Legislative Caucus for Young Children.  Gile also serves as an Advisory Board Member for the Early Childhood Education at New Hampshire Technical Institute.

“Representative Gile is a distinguished member of the State Legislature and a great representative for the people of Concord,” said Dodd New Hampshire Press Secretary Bryan DeAngelis.  “She brings a wealth of knowledge to Senator Dodd’s campaign and will be a tremendous asset to the campaign’s efforts in Concord and across New Hampshire.  Senator Dodd and the entire campaign are excited to have the support of Representative Gile.”

Senator Dodd recently visited Concord on his last trip to New Hampshire.  He spoke to environmental activists about his energy plan at the offices of the New Hampshire Sierra Club.  Dodd also visited Salem, Plymouth, Gorham, Berlin, Conway, and Grantham.
